当前位置: 首页 > news >正文

3个步骤告别Mac数字垃圾:Pearcleaner深度清理实战指南

3个步骤告别Mac数字垃圾:Pearcleaner深度清理实战指南

【免费下载链接】PearcleanerA free, source-available and fair-code licensed mac app cleaner项目地址: https://gitcode.com/gh_mirrors/pe/Pearcleaner

你是否曾经在Mac上删除应用后,依然感觉系统不够清爽?那些隐藏在角落的配置文件、缓存文件和日志文件就像数字世界的"幽灵",悄悄占用着宝贵的存储空间,拖慢系统运行速度。今天,让我们一起来探索Pearcleaner这款开源macOS清理工具,看看它如何彻底解决这个困扰无数Mac用户的难题。

第一章:数字幽灵的藏身之处 - 认识macOS应用残留

想象一下这个场景:你在Mac上安装了20个应用程序,经过一段时间的使用,决定卸载其中10个。你以为删除操作已经完成,但实际上,这些应用在系统中留下了大量的"数字足迹"。

隐藏的垃圾文件在哪里?

这些残留文件通常藏在以下几个地方:

  • 用户库文件夹:每个用户独有的应用数据存储区
  • 系统级支持文件夹:跨用户共享的应用组件
  • 缓存和临时文件:应用运行时产生的临时数据
  • 偏好设置数据库:应用配置信息的存储位置
  • 启动项和服务注册:应用在系统层面的注册信息

![Pearcleaner机械梨图标展示](https://raw.gitcode.com/gh_mirrors/pe/Pearcleaner/raw/1b3e07a484e36a09a6602836a85821d03f4ff491/Pear Resources/Pear.png?utm_source=gitcode_repo_files)

这张图片中的机械梨图标完美诠释了Pearcleaner的设计理念——将自然的简洁(梨)与科技的精密(机械齿轮)相结合。就像这个图标一样,Pearcleaner既保持了操作的直观性,又拥有强大的技术内核。

第二章:从混乱到有序 - Pearcleaner的智能清理哲学

2.1 双重验证机制:确保清理的安全性

Pearcleaner采用独特的Bundle ID和文件结构双重验证系统。这就像给你的Mac清理操作加上了双重保险:

  1. Bundle ID验证:通过应用的唯一标识符确认身份
  2. 文件结构分析:检查文件的关联性和依赖性
  3. 智能风险评估:自动识别系统关键文件并加以保护

2.2 Sentinel监控模式:24小时自动守护

启用Sentinel模式后,Pearcleaner会像忠实的哨兵一样,时刻监控你的应用删除行为。当检测到应用被拖入废纸篓时,它会自动启动清理流程,整个过程仅占用约2MB内存。

监控模式的工作原理:

应用删除 → Sentinel检测 → 自动扫描 → 智能清理 → 完成报告

2.3 架构优化:为Apple Silicon和Intel双架构量身定制

对于拥有Apple Silicon芯片的Mac用户,Pearcleaner提供了一个特别有用的功能——架构优化。它可以:

  • 识别应用中的冗余架构代码
  • 移除不必要的CPU架构支持文件
  • 减少应用体积,提升启动速度
  • 优化内存使用效率

第三章:实战演练 - 3步完成彻底清理

第一步:安装与配置

Homebrew安装(开发者首选)

brew install --cask pearcleaner

手动安装流程

  1. 从项目仓库下载最新版本:git clone https://gitcode.com/gh_mirrors/pe/Pearcleaner
  2. 在Xcode中打开项目并构建
  3. 将生成的Pearcleaner应用拖入Applications文件夹
  4. 首次运行时授予必要的系统权限

权限配置清单:| 权限类型 | 用途 | 重要性 | |---------|------|--------| | 完全磁盘访问 | 扫描系统文件 | 必需 | | 特权助手 | 操作系统级文件夹 | 必需 | | 通知权限 | 清理完成提醒 | 可选 |

第二步:智能扫描与文件识别

打开Pearcleaner后,你会看到一个简洁直观的界面。选择要清理的应用,点击扫描按钮,Pearcleaner会启动深度扫描算法。

扫描过程解析:

  1. 快速索引:建立应用文件关联数据库
  2. 深度遍历:递归搜索所有相关目录
  3. 智能过滤:排除系统关键文件和用户指定保护项
  4. 风险评估:标记潜在的重要配置文件

![Pearcleaner清新梨图标](https://raw.gitcode.com/gh_mirrors/pe/Pearcleaner/raw/1b3e07a484e36a09a6602836a85821d03f4ff491/Pear Resources/new-pear.png?utm_source=gitcode_repo_files)

这个清新的梨图标代表了Pearcleaner的另一面——简洁、直观的用户体验。就像新鲜水果一样,Pearcleaner让你的Mac系统恢复清爽状态。

第三步:精准清理与历史管理

扫描完成后,Pearcleaner会显示详细的文件列表,包括:

  • 待删除文件:明确标记为可安全删除的项目
  • 建议保留文件:可能包含重要配置的文件
  • 系统文件:自动识别并保护的macOS核心组件

清理策略选择:

  • 标准清理:删除所有非必要文件
  • 保守清理:保留偏好设置和用户数据
  • 自定义清理:手动选择要删除的文件类型

第四章:进阶技巧 - 挖掘Pearcleaner的隐藏潜力

4.1 命令行大师模式

对于喜欢终端操作的用户,Pearcleaner提供了完整的命令行接口:

# 启用命令行工具 ln -s /Applications/Pearcleaner.app/Contents/MacOS/Pearcleaner /usr/local/bin/pear # 基础命令示例 pear scan com.company.appname # 扫描特定应用 pear cleanup --dry-run # 模拟清理(不实际删除) pear history --last 5 # 查看最近5次清理记录 pear exclude ~/Documents/work # 设置排除目录

4.2 Homebrew生态深度集成

Pearcleaner不仅支持普通macOS应用,还能智能管理Homebrew包:

Homebrew专用功能:

  • 包依赖分析:识别并管理包之间的依赖关系
  • 版本控制:查看和管理不同版本的包
  • 智能卸载:自动处理依赖链和配置文件
  • 缓存清理:清理Homebrew下载缓存和构建文件

4.3 开发环境优化

程序员和开发者可以从这些功能中获益:

  1. Xcode项目清理:移除旧的DerivedData和模拟器缓存
  2. Node.js模块管理:清理node_modules中的重复依赖
  3. Python虚拟环境:优化venv和pip缓存
  4. Docker镜像清理:管理本地Docker存储空间

第五章:场景化应用 - 真实用户案例

案例一:设计师的创意工作流清理

用户背景:平面设计师,使用Adobe Creative Cloud套件痛点:每次更新Adobe应用后,旧版本文件占用大量空间解决方案

  1. 使用Pearcleaner扫描所有Adobe应用
  2. 识别并删除旧版本的支持文件
  3. 保留当前版本的配置和预设
  4. 定期执行维护性清理

效果:释放了45GB存储空间,应用启动速度提升30%

案例二:开发者的多项目环境管理

用户背景:全栈开发者,同时维护多个项目痛点:不同项目的依赖和缓存文件混杂解决方案

  1. 配置Pearcleaner排除项目目录
  2. 设置定期自动清理计划
  3. 使用命令行接口批量管理
  4. 集成到开发工作流脚本中

效果:构建时间减少25%,磁盘空间使用更高效

案例三:普通用户的日常维护

用户背景:非技术用户,使用Mac处理日常事务痛点:不知道哪些文件可以安全删除解决方案

  1. 启用Sentinel自动监控模式
  2. 使用预设的安全清理模板
  3. 定期查看清理报告了解系统状态
  4. 学习基本的文件类型识别知识

效果:系统运行更流畅,不再担心误删重要文件

第六章:最佳实践与安全指南

6.1 建立健康的清理习惯

推荐维护时间表:

  • 每日:快速检查最近删除的应用(通过Sentinel模式自动完成)
  • 每周:手动扫描1-2个大型应用
  • 每月:执行全面系统扫描
  • 每季度:深度清理和架构优化

6.2 数据安全防护措施

虽然Pearcleaner设计安全,但遵循这些原则能提供额外保障:

  1. 重要文件备份:清理前使用Time Machine或云备份
  2. 配置文件保护:对于重要应用,选择保留设置选项
  3. 清理历史记录:定期查看清理历史,了解系统变化
  4. 测试环境验证:在次要设备上测试新清理策略

6.3 故障排除与恢复

如果遇到问题,可以尝试以下步骤:

  1. 检查权限设置:确保Pearcleaner有足够的系统权限
  2. 查看日志文件:在~/Library/Logs/Pearcleaner中查找详细日志
  3. 重置配置:删除偏好设置文件重新开始
  4. 联系社区:在项目仓库中寻求帮助

第七章:未来展望 - Pearcleaner的发展路线

基于项目的当前架构和代码结构,Pearcleaner正在向以下方向演进:

技术架构优化

  • 模块化设计:Logic目录下的各个组件独立发展
  • 跨平台支持:探索其他操作系统的可能性
  • AI增强:利用机器学习优化文件识别算法

用户体验提升

  • 更智能的推荐:基于使用习惯的个性化清理建议
  • 可视化分析:图形化展示存储空间使用情况
  • 社区贡献:用户共享的清理规则和最佳实践

生态系统扩展

  • 插件系统:支持第三方清理模块
  • API开放:为其他工具提供集成接口
  • 云同步:跨设备同步清理配置和历史

结语:重新定义macOS清理体验

Pearcleaner不仅仅是一个清理工具,它代表了一种全新的macOS维护理念——智能、安全、彻底。通过将复杂的系统清理操作简化为直观的用户界面,它让每个Mac用户都能轻松管理自己的数字环境。

无论你是技术爱好者还是普通用户,Pearcleaner都能为你提供专业级的系统维护服务。它的开源特性意味着透明、可信,而活跃的社区开发确保了持续的改进和支持。

现在就开始你的Mac清理之旅吧。下载Pearcleaner,体验真正彻底的macOS应用清理,让你的Mac恢复出厂般的清爽状态,享受更高效、更流畅的数字生活。

立即行动清单:

  1. 访问项目仓库获取最新版本
  2. 按照指南完成安装和配置
  3. 执行首次全面扫描了解系统状态
  4. 根据个人需求调整清理策略
  5. 建立定期的维护计划

记住,一个干净的系统不仅意味着更多的存储空间,更代表着更好的性能、更高的安全性和更愉悦的使用体验。让Pearcleaner成为你Mac维护的得力助手,开启高效的数字生活新篇章。

【免费下载链接】PearcleanerA free, source-available and fair-code licensed mac app cleaner项目地址: https://gitcode.com/gh_mirrors/pe/Pearcleaner

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

http://www.jsqmd.com/news/1001345/

相关文章:

  • 别再死记硬背了!用几个真实代码片段,帮你彻底搞懂TypeScript的interface和type
  • 实验6-3低代码数据可视化进阶:用蓝图编辑器实现浏览器分析大屏联动交互
  • 从CIFAR到细粒度数据集:手把手教你用SSB基准重新评估你的OSR模型
  • 2026年HDPE双壁波纹管选购指南:湖南源头工厂实力对比与选型建议 - GrowthUME
  • STM32CubeMX配置OSAL内存与中断管理详解:从源码层面理解如何适配你的MCU
  • 民宿/网约房数字化升级:基于智能锁的身份核验与远程授权解决方案
  • 2026年6月最新解读:东莞精密模具定制服务商全面测评与优质供应商推荐 - GrowthUME
  • 如何精准控制Windows电脑风扇:FanControl完全配置指南
  • 【无人机路径规划】实现有效的水陆两栖无人机任务规划和执行附Matlab代码(含粒子群优化和遗传算法)
  • 2026武汉医护类中职学校多维度评测:资质合规升学通道管理服务实训水平 - GrowthUME
  • PyTorch模型部署实战:model.eval()和torch.no_grad()到底该用哪个?(附代码对比)
  • i.MX27L嵌入式系统设计:Smart Speed™架构与低功耗实战解析
  • 企业多业务网络隔离不求人:用华为交换机的IP子网VLAN,5步搞定IPTV、语音、数据分流
  • Spring ResolvableType说明
  • 选题毫无头绪?博导推荐这几个AI论文软件
  • 别再只会用朴素算法了!LCA问题从入门到精通:倍增与Tarjan实战详解(附C++代码)
  • 终极下载管理解决方案:AB Download Manager如何让你的文件下载速度翻倍且井井有条
  • 终极解决方案:如何用VisualCppRedist AIO一键解决Windows程序运行依赖问题
  • 父亲节不同兴趣的爸爸送什么礼物才不闲置?先看这6个判断标准 - GrowthUME
  • 从PlenOctrees到3DGS:聊聊球面谐波(SH)在三维重建中的‘上位史’与选型指南
  • MPC5674F:高效发动机控制核心架构、外设与应用实战解析
  • 5分钟快速上手:CheatEngine-DMA插件高效内存修改完整指南
  • 若依框架下Spring Security多用户表登录的两种姿势:从“框架原生”到“手动接管”的完整对比与选型指南
  • 2026重庆iPhone 17屏幕维修深度解析:从超薄玻璃到微米级贴合的技术博弈
  • MATLAB版非均匀傅里叶变换工具集:含NUSFT原创算法与多种加速实现
  • WordPress AI评论助手:人机协同回复实战指南
  • 2026实测:微信视频号视频保存到手机相册方法,视频号视频无法直接下载怎么办
  • 2026巴州库尔勒学车考驾照全流程攻略:品类选型、合规标准及落地指南 - GrowthUME
  • 别再只学K8s了!从Docker原理到etcd集群搭建,这份云原生底层核心知识清单请收好
  • 深入SAP替代逻辑:从一次MIGO的GB032错误,理解ABAP代码生成器与GBTMSFIC